money-rails

    0热度

    1回答

    我想修改这样的纪念章(以美元为例)。如果高于15.01应该舍入到16)(例如:15.01或15.10或15.50或15.90应该交换到16) 任何帮助理解

    0热度

    2回答

    林整合支付网关内使用的助手,进出口使用宝石money-rails用于处理金钱在我的应用程序,从我的控制器,我有做一个用户收取费用的信用卡的行为,我想用佣工钱轨已,但它应该是怎样,你只能使用来自视图助手话,我不知道如何正确地获取发送到支付网关的金额,例如,如果我有以下的钱对象: ruby <Money fractional:650 currency:USD> 我想获得价值6.5,用于然后将其发送到网

    0热度

    2回答

    我有场 monetize :unit_price_cents, as: 'unit_price', with_model_currency: :unit_price_currency 它输入数据库是浮动。而我想在数据库中保存值保留6个十进制值。在Money GEM中,我定制成功了: Money.new(1.123456).to_f => 0.01123456 我调试了一些func,并认为这

    0热度

    3回答

    我想humanized_money_with_symbol方法返回类似USD$ 100,不仅$ 100。另外我想这样做只有当货币符号是$时,我们想让用户知道什么时候$是USD和AUD。

    -1热度

    1回答

    我在Rails应用中使用money gem进行货币换算,并需要为表单选择标记生成货币列表。 建议的文件依赖拨打Money::Currency.table获取所有货币的列表,但这包括非iso货币(例如比特币)和旧货币(例如三个无效的津巴布韦美元条目)。 有没有办法只获取一个有效的ISO货币代码列表,而无需维护我自己的列表?

    0热度

    1回答

    取代具有整数_cents场和_currency字符串字段的,我创建了一个货币模型,其中有: iso_code usd_rate(汇率USD) 名 防爆amples: 美元 iso_code:“USD” usd_rate: 名称:“美圆” 你知道我该怎么做才能将这款模型与金钱宝石融为一体? (我的意思是,对于具有货币的参考,而不是保存iso_code,并在货币模型中使用的汇率)

    0热度

    1回答

    我正在使用rails-money宝石作为我正在构建的事件应用程序的第一次。我有一个事件模型,它有一个类型为“整数”的“价格”列。我希望用户能够输入他们想要的任何变化(在合理的范围内)以获得事件成本 - 例如15.99英镑,15.99英镑等等,但是节目输出需要看起来整齐而恰当(15.99英镑)。此刻,我的输入字段允许我在表单上放置一个小数点,但它无法在显示页面上识别此数据(15.99英镑仅显示为15

    0热度

    2回答

    我试图实现货币轨和我遇到了以下错误: undefined method `cents' for "1,000.00":String 我跟着this tutorial得到一个‘神奇’的货币输入字段。 DB模式: t.integer "balance_cents", default: 0, null: false t.string "balance_currency", default: "USD

    1热度

    1回答

    我通过简单的计算器应用程序工作我的方式... 试图整合在它的钱,宝石,但是迷茫...... 这是当前模式(如你可以看到,它没有与_cents结尾的列...和非常困惑是否需要_cents部分... 当前架构 ActiveRecord::Schema.define(version: 20170301051956) do # These are extensions that must be

    0热度

    1回答

    我想一轮的价格这样 1.5〜1 1.6〜2 这样做 我加了一个模型,并创建了一个方法,在lib文件夹像这样 class EuCentralBank < Money::Bank::VariableExchange def calculate_exchange(from, to_currency, rate) to_currency_money = Money::Currency.